Kelly Ann King-Taylor has been an independent floor broker on the agricultural trading floor of the Chicago Board of Trade since 1997. She has held positions on both the Membership and Conduct Committees serving the exchange. Before obtaining her membership to become a broker, beginning in 1988 she held numerous clerical positions for other brokers and traders, as well as a retail firm which gave her exposure to both the customer and execution sides of the business.
Mrs. King-Taylor also owned and operated a small recording studio with a partner from 2002-2005.
In 2006 she helped to found a non-profit, W.H.Y. Community Development which provides after-school tutoring, health education and summer programs for disadvantaged kids on Chicago's south side. She serves as Vice President on the board of directors.
Mrs. King-Taylor holds a B.A. from Marquette University and an M.S. from Northwestern University.
